II.CXXIX. 'Tis by the Faith of Joys to come

1 'Tis by the Faith of Joys to come
We walk through Desarts dark as Night;
Till we arrive at Heav'n our Home,
Faith is our Guide, and Faith our Light.

2 The Want of Sight she well supplies,
She makes the pearly Gates appear;
Far into distant Worlds she pries,
And brings eternal Glories near.

3 Chearful we tread the Desart through,
While Faith inspires a heav'nly Ray;
Though Lions roar, and Tempests blow,
And Rocks and Dangers fill the Way.

4 So Abra'm, by Divine Command,
Left his own House to walk with God;
His Faith beheld the promis'd Land,
And fir'd his Zeal along the Road.
